Rated Gold by Sunderland City Council
Staff and residents at Barnes Court of Wycliffe Road in High Barnes are celebrating being awarded a ‘Gold’ rating by Sunderland City Council for the second year running.
Sunderland City Council operates a Quality Standard Assessment process which inspects 50 homes within the Sunderland area and then provides the home with a Quality Rating. The inspection process judges homes based on the safety of residents, effectiveness, leadership, responsiveness and the caring element of the service.

Gold Standard in North Yorkshire Healthier Choices Awards
Good food should be savoured and celebrated.
Belmont House is proud to be one of a few businesses in the area to be accredited with the Gold Standard in North Yorkshire County Council’s ‘healthier choices’ awards, an initiative to recognise those businesses that are providing their customers with healthier eating choices.
To qualify for the award the menu options are judged on their nutritional value and how they ensure the meals are balanced, prepared and cooked in a health-conscious manner without compromising on taste or customer satisfaction.
